    Make check-spaces part of the standard "make check" process
    
    To do this, we had to make sure it passes when the changes directory
    is empty.  I also tried to improve the quality of the output, and
    fix some false-positive cases.  Let's see how this goes!
    
    Closes ticket 23564.

+def files(args):
+    """Walk through the arguments: for directories, yield their contents;
+       for files, just yield the files. Only search one level deep, because
+       that's how the changes directory is laid out."""
+    for f in args:
+        if os.path.isdir(f):
+            for item in os.listdir(f):
+                if item.startswith("."): #ignore dotfiles
+                    continue
+                yield os.path.join(f, item)
+        else:
+            yield f

+  o Minor features (build):
+    - The "check-changes" feature is now part of the "make check"
+      tests; we'll use it to try to prevent misformed changes files
+      from accumulating.  Closes ticket 23564.
